Post by guho on Dec 11, 2019 19:38:34 GMT
Yes I installed it last night on xp sp3 mce2005. Went perfectly. Thanks again for keeping this link up to date for the unlikely folks like myself who get an XL1B for the first time almost in 2020.
Is B107 the latest firmware for the drive itself? Mine came with B100 but I found B107 on station-drivers. And for the mechanism i found fw 0.08 but it did not apply likely because I already have that firmware. If anyone reading this has later firmwares, please reply.
Now, i am wondering how to clear the xl1b memory. According to the mediachanger command line tool, it thinks slots 0-71 are occupied even though the machine is empty. I hope there is a way that does not involve removing the battery from the main board. Tonight, i am just going to let it scan the whole machine with a few discs in it, hopefully that will fix the phantom discs. This machine does not seem to employ sensors to detect which slots are occupied.
